PoW から PoS コンセンサスメカニズムの開発に至るまで、「誰がブロックを生成するのか」という共通の問題に直面し、ネットワークの運用を安全かつ効率的に維持するにはどうすればよいのか、2 つの章を使って直面する問題を詳細に分析します。現在の業界のソリューションとPlatONのソリューションがあります。
ブロックチェーン技術は、分散化、非改ざん性、検証可能性、追跡可能性という特徴により、政府、金融機関、社会団体から高く評価されています。 「コンセンサスメカニズム」はブロックチェーンの中核として、セキュリティ、分散性、スケーラビリティなどのブロックチェーンの重要な特性を決定するため、特に重要です。
ビットコインが当初提案したPoWコンセンサスメカニズムは、困難な問題の解を継続的に計算するための計算能力を通じて簿記権を獲得するため、リソースの無駄が発生し、効率が低くなります。分散化の喪失。
副題
乱数スキーム
本質的に、PoW と PoS はどちらも、誰がブロックを作成するのか、そして分散型台帳を維持するためにブロックについて安全かつ効率的に合意に達する方法を解決します。
分散化とセキュリティをより適切に実現するには、選択されるノードがランダムである必要があります。そのため、誰もが納得する安全で一貫性のある乱数をいかにして取得するかが重要な課題となっています。
副題
VRF
副題
BLS しきい値署名
副題
PVSS
副題
VDF
スタンフォード大学暗号学教授の Dan Boneh 氏らが論文 Verifiable Delay Function で提案した VDF は、結果の一意性とプロセスの連続性を保証できる数学関数であり、いくつかの入力パラメーター (日付や時刻など) を受け入れます。 ) 計算には結果が得られるまでに少なくとも一定の時間がかかることが保証されており、検証者は入力パラメータに従って結果の正しさを迅速に検証できます。
要約する
要約する
さまざまな実装スキームにはそれぞれ長所と短所があり、さまざまな観点と異なる目標からさまざまなソリューションが作成されますが、最終的には、さまざまなランダム選択スキームがどのように実装されたとしても、最終的には分散化、セキュリティ、および高いパフォーマンスを確保することを目的としている必要があります。
次回の記事では、PlatONにおけるバリデータ選出のランダム方式について紹介しますので、お楽しみに!
